site stats

Query evaluation plan in dbms

WebChapter 12: Query Processing Author: Silberschatz, Korth and Sudarshan Last modified by: darioVB Created Date: 2/23/2000 6:58:38 PM Document presentation format: Presentazione su schermo (4:3) Other titles WebOct 7, 2024 · Query Tree – Query Evaluation Plan / Expression EvaluationIntroductionA query tree is a tree structure that represents a relational algebra expression :Each ...

Query Processing in DBMS - Scaler Topics

WebSep 4, 2024 · To instruct Oracle to store the actual execution plan for a given SQL query, you can use the GATHER_PLAN_STATISTICS query hint: SELECT /*+ GATHER_PLAN_STATISTICS */ p.id FROM post p WHERE EXISTS ( SELECT 1 FROM post_comment pc WHERE pc.post_id = p.id AND pc.review = 'Bingo' ) ORDER BY p.title … WebWork included designing query language features, query evaluation algorithms, and data layout techniques to enable declarative queries … kitchenaid kmbd104gss spec sheet https://spencerslive.com

How to make DB2 re-evaluate the query plan each execution?

WebQuery Optimization in DBMS is the process of selecting the most efficient way to execute a SQL statement. Because SQL is a nonprocedural language, the optimizer can merge, … WebJul 24, 2014 · The Query execution engine picks up a query evaluation plan, executes that plan, and returns the result to the query. ... Ability to process queries in a timely manner is one of the most critical functional requirements of a DBMS. This is particularly proves for very large, mission critical applications such as banking systems, ... WebFeb 17, 2024 · 1. Review the query folding indicators. 2. Select the query step to review its query plan. 3. Implement changes to your query. Query plan for Power Query is a feature … kitchenaid kmbp100ess in stock

8.9.1 Controlling Query Plan Evaluation - Oracle

Category:Cardinality Estimation in DBMS: A Comprehensive Benchmark Evaluation

Tags:Query evaluation plan in dbms

Query evaluation plan in dbms

Rule-based Query Optimization Querify Labs

WebThe evaluation primitives carry the instructions needed for the evaluation of the operation. Thus, a query evaluation plan defines a sequence of primitive operations used for … WebThe second step is Query Optimizer. In this, it transforms the query into equivalent expressions that are more efficient to execute. The third step is Query evaluation. It executes the above query execution plan and returns the result. Translating SQL Queries into Relational Algebra

Query evaluation plan in dbms

Did you know?

WebSep 13, 2024 · Cardinality estimation (CardEst) plays a significant role in generating high-quality query plans for a query optimizer in DBMS. In the last decade, an increasing number of advanced CardEst methods (especially ML-based) have been proposed with outstanding estimation accuracy and inference latency. However, there exists no study that … WebStep 1: Queries are parsed into internal forms (e.g., parse trees) Step 2: Internal forms are transformed into Zcanonical forms (syntactic query optimization) Step 3: A subset of alternative plans are enumerated Step 4: Costs for alternative plans are estimated Step 5: The query evaluation plan with the least estimated

WebSep 13, 2024 · Cardinality estimation (CardEst) plays a significant role in generating high-quality query plans for a query optimizer in DBMS. In the last decade, an increasing … WebLecture 10: Parallel Query Evaluation Instructor: Paris Koutris 2016 In parallel database systems, we want to speed up the evaluation of relational queries by throwing more machines to the problem in hand. Contrast this to distributed database systems, where data may be stored across different machines in potentially different databases.

WebRelational algebra defines the basic set of operations of relational database model. A sequence of relational algebra operations forms a relational algebra expression. The result of this expression represents the result of a database query. The basic operations are −. … WebFeb 24, 2012 · Overview of Query Evaluation System catalogs is used to find the best way to evaluate the query SQL queries are translated into an extended form of relational …

WebSep 18, 2024 · To select a query plan, DQ uses a neural network that encodes the compressed versions of the classical dynamic programming tables observed at training time. DQ touches only the tip of the iceberg. In the database and systems communities , intensifying debate has revolved around putting more learning, or in other words, data …

WebApr 5, 2016 · Query processors come with the following components, DDL Interpreter: It interprets the DDL statements and records the definitions in data dictionary. DML Compiler: It translates the DML statements in a query language into an evaluation plan consisting of low-level instructions that the query evaluation understands. It also performs query ... kitchenaid kmbd104gss microwave drawerWebJul 6, 2024 · The query execution engine takes a query evaluation plan, executes that plan and produces the desired output. The different execution plans for a given query can have … kitchenaid kmbd104gss microwave ovenWebJan 5, 2008 · After the evaluation plan has been selected, it is passed into the DMBS’ query-execution engine [12] (also referred to as the runtime database processor 5]), [where the plan is executed and the results are returned. 3.1 Parsing and Translating the Query The first step in processing a query submitted to a DBMS is to convert the query into a ... kitchenaid kmbp100ess reviewsWebThe task of the query optimizer is to find an optimal plan for executing an SQL query. Because the difference in performance between “ good ” and “ bad ” plans can be orders … kitchenaid kmbs104ess installation manualWebThis videos describes materialization and pipelining which are methods of evaluating queries in DBMS.Review Questions:1. What is an operator tree?2. Why do w... kitchenaid kmcc1er stand mixer cloth coverWebQuery Evaluation Plan. o In order to fully evaluate a query, the system needs to construct a query evaluation plan. o The annotations in the evaluation plan may refer to the algorithms to be used for the particular index or the specific operations. o Such relational algebra with annotations is referred to as Evaluation Primitives. kitchenaid kmbp100ess spec sheetWebOne-line summary: An encyclopoedic survey of query evaluation techniques - sorting, hashing, disk access, and aggregation/duplicate removal are dealt with in these sections (1-4) of the paper. Overview/Main Points. Steps to process a query: parsing, validation, resolution, optimization, plan compilation, execution. kitchenaid kmbp107ess reviews